Democracy’s Second Act: Productive Publics and a Future Beyond Polarization

Thursday, Oct. 26, 3:30-5 p.m.

IIC-2001, Bruneau Centre for Research and Innovation

Join us for a discussion with one of the world’s foremost experts on Citizens’ Assemblies, Peter MacLeod (Founder and Principal of MASS LBP), as he describes his vision for a more participatory and ambitious approach to democractic politics. His presentation will be followed by a panel discussion on the role of civic engagement in NL. Panelists include Jen Crowe (Choices for Youth), Bettina Ford (Community Sector Council/Deputy Mayor of Gander) and Katherine Dibbons (political science student and former chair Premier’s Youth Council).
